Problem mit xBase++ 1.82 und xBaseTOOLS
Moderator: Moderatoren
Problem mit xBase++ 1.82 und xBaseTOOLS
Ich hab momentan noch die Demo von xBase 1.82 und die Demo eXpress 1.9. Weiterhin benutze ich die XbToolsIII Version 1.7
Ich hab nun mein Project neu kompiliert und nun kommt bei jedem Programm (wenn Funktionen der Tools dabei sind) der Fehler:
Der Prozedureinsprungspunkt "__This_DLL-needs_version_1_70_0" wurde in der DLL "XPPRT1.DLL" nicht gefunden.
Heißt das nun, das ich die Tools auch updaten muß?
Ich benutze folgende Funktionen:
setcleara (könnte ich verzichten)
deletefile, filecopy, diskready,diskreadyw,dton,dirmake,filedelete,strfile
Was gibts für Alternativen in xBase++ und/oder eXPress?
Ich hab nun mein Project neu kompiliert und nun kommt bei jedem Programm (wenn Funktionen der Tools dabei sind) der Fehler:
Der Prozedureinsprungspunkt "__This_DLL-needs_version_1_70_0" wurde in der DLL "XPPRT1.DLL" nicht gefunden.
Heißt das nun, das ich die Tools auch updaten muß?
Ich benutze folgende Funktionen:
setcleara (könnte ich verzichten)
deletefile, filecopy, diskready,diskreadyw,dton,dirmake,filedelete,strfile
Was gibts für Alternativen in xBase++ und/oder eXPress?
- Martin Altmann
- Foren-Administrator
- Beiträge: 16517
- Registriert: Fr, 23. Sep 2005 4:58
- Wohnort: Berlin
- Hat sich bedankt: 111 Mal
- Danksagung erhalten: 48 Mal
- Kontaktdaten:
Re: Problem mit xBase++ 1.82 und xBaseTOOLS
Hallo Josef,
Viele Grüße (und ein frohes Neues!),
Martin
ich würde mal denken: Ja! Aber davon sollte es doch auch eine Demoversion geben, oder?Josef hat geschrieben:Heißt das nun, das ich die Tools auch updaten muß?
Viele Grüße (und ein frohes Neues!),
Martin
- Martin Altmann
- Foren-Administrator
- Beiträge: 16517
- Registriert: Fr, 23. Sep 2005 4:58
- Wohnort: Berlin
- Hat sich bedankt: 111 Mal
- Danksagung erhalten: 48 Mal
- Kontaktdaten:
- Jan
- Marvin
- Beiträge: 14655
- Registriert: Fr, 23. Sep 2005 18:23
- Wohnort: 49328 Melle
- Hat sich bedankt: 21 Mal
- Danksagung erhalten: 88 Mal
- Kontaktdaten:
Hallo Josef,
Du darfst NIEMALS Xbase++ und die Tools aus verschiedenen Versionen mischen. Das ist, als ob Du Xbase 1.82 mit DLLs aus einer früheren Version mischst, das geht immer schief. Und die Fehlermeldung ist genau die aus Xbase++ bis einschließlich 1.82. Ab 1.9 ist die anders. Allerdinsg auch sehr nichtssagend und irreführend.
Jan
Du darfst NIEMALS Xbase++ und die Tools aus verschiedenen Versionen mischen. Das ist, als ob Du Xbase 1.82 mit DLLs aus einer früheren Version mischst, das geht immer schief. Und die Fehlermeldung ist genau die aus Xbase++ bis einschließlich 1.82. Ab 1.9 ist die anders. Allerdinsg auch sehr nichtssagend und irreführend.
Jan
- Armin
- Rekursionen-Architekt
- Beiträge: 393
- Registriert: Mo, 26. Sep 2005 12:09
- Wohnort: 75331 Engelsbrand
- Danksagung erhalten: 3 Mal
- Kontaktdaten:
Hallo Josef,
ERASE (deletefile, filedelete)
COPY (filecopy)
mit directory() kannst evtl. diskready...() ersetzen - Attribute lesen
mit file() kann man auch einiges anstellen
DTON() klingt wie date() to numeric...? Kann ich nirgends finden. Wie wärs mit einer Variante mit DAY()
cCmd1:="md ....."
dirmake() - RunShell( "/C "+cCmd1, "cmd.exe",.f.,.t.)
StrFile() sollte mit Fopen() und FWrite() ersetzbar sein...
ansonsten aktuelle XBTools organisieren.
Gruß Armin
ERASE (deletefile, filedelete)
COPY (filecopy)
mit directory() kannst evtl. diskready...() ersetzen - Attribute lesen
mit file() kann man auch einiges anstellen
DTON() klingt wie date() to numeric...? Kann ich nirgends finden. Wie wärs mit einer Variante mit DAY()
cCmd1:="md ....."
dirmake() - RunShell( "/C "+cCmd1, "cmd.exe",.f.,.t.)
StrFile() sollte mit Fopen() und FWrite() ersetzbar sein...
ansonsten aktuelle XBTools organisieren.
Gruß Armin
- Martin Altmann
- Foren-Administrator
- Beiträge: 16517
- Registriert: Fr, 23. Sep 2005 4:58
- Wohnort: Berlin
- Hat sich bedankt: 111 Mal
- Danksagung erhalten: 48 Mal
- Kontaktdaten: